Local eating places attract Central students Popular hangouts for Centralites this year seemed to consist mainly of eating places. Among the favorites were Scotty's, Taco John's, and McDonald's. Since the administration decided to give all students open campus this year, many of them could be found at some eating place during the school day. Smile. . .you're on Central's camera! Picture yourself 20 years from now sitting in your armchair, dusting off your 1975 Eagle. What will you remember? Of course, homecoming, Sadie Hawkins, powder puff, and the prom will stand out in your memory, but what about the everyday good times? Barrelling through the tunnel at top speed, squeezing through‘the crowded stairways, choking down those yummy school lunches in order to get to class on time, getting kicked out of the library for being obnoxious-this is what makes up everyday life. So, when you reminisce about the good old days remember the little things about Central that make your high school years a special time. a Eddie Grote escapes the clutches e Central's mad man.
